What affects the price

Legal fees vary based on the specific charges you face and the complexity of the evidence involved. A case requiring extensive investigation, expert witnesses, or multiple court appearances will naturally cost more than a straightforward matter that resolves quickly. What's the difference between a criminal lawyer and a defense lawyer?

Essentially, a criminal lawyer focuses on all aspects of criminal law, including prosecution. A criminal defense lawyer, however, specifically represents individuals accused of crimes. They work to protect your rights and build the strongest possible defense against the charges you face in Milwaukee. It's about having someone solely dedicated to your side.

When should I hire a criminal lawyer?

You should consider hiring a criminal lawyer in Milwaukee as soon as possible after an arrest or if you believe you are under investigation. Early intervention is key. An experienced attorney can advise you on how to interact with law enforcement and prevent missteps that could harm your case. What is the hardest criminal case to beat?

Cases involving overwhelming physical evidence or confessions can be particularly challenging to defend in Milwaukee. However, even in difficult situations, a strong defense lawyer can challenge the admissibility of evidence, identify procedural errors, or negotiate favorable plea deals. The key is a thorough investigation and strategic legal approach.
